
Located in the Binna Burra section of Lamington National Park, this circuit takes walkers through a fascinating variety of forest and heath. Dave's Creek Circuit descends through the head of Nixons Creek out into Dave's Creek country.
The track passes through several distinctive vegetation types: warm and cool subtropical rainforest along the Border Track; warm temperate rainforest containing many examples of ancient angiosperms such as coachwood in the Nixons Creek headwaters; and wet sclerophyll forest with giant New England ash around Nagarigoon clearing.
| Distance: | 12 kilometres |
| Duration: | 4-5 hours |
| Type: | Return |
| Start Point: | The track leaves the Border Track 2.3km from the Binna Burra car park. |

| Walk Hints: |
This is a relatively easy walk for those with a moderate level of fitness and bushwalking experience. Watch your step - the track is uneven and a bit slippery in places. The return steady climb can be tiring. |
| Best Time To Go: | The cooler months are best for this more exposed track. See the wildflowers in spring. |
| Free Entry: | Yes. |
